Is it der, die oder das Zuspitzung?

DIE

The correct article in German of Zuspitzung is die. So it is die Zuspitzung! (nominative case)

The word Zuspitzung is feminine, therefore the correct article is die.

The most difficult part of learning the German language is the articles (der, die, das) or rather the gender of each noun. The gender of each noun in German has no simple rule. In fact, it can even seem illogical. For example das Mädchen, a young girl is neutral while der Junge, a young boy is male.

It is a good idea to learn the correct article for each new word together - even if it means a lot of work. For example learning "der Hund" (the dog) rather than just Hund by itself. Fortunately, there are some rules about gender in German that make things a little easier. It might be even nicer if these rules didn't have exceptions - but you can't have everything! German nouns belong either to the gender masculine (male, standard gender) with the definite article der, to the feminine (feminine) with the definite article die, or to the neuter (neuter) with the definite article das.

  • for masculine: points of the compass, weather (Osten, Monsun, Sturm; however it is: das Gewitter), liquor/spirits (Wodka, Wein, Kognak), minerals, rocks (Marmor, Quarz, Granit, Diamant);

  • for feminine: ships and airplanes (die Deutschland, die Boeing; however it is: der Airbus), cigarette brands (Camel, Marlboro), many tree and plant species (Eiche, Pappel, Kiefer; aber: der Flieder), numbers (Eins, Million; however it is: das Dutzend), most inland rivers (Elbe, Oder, Donau; aber: der Rhein);

  • for neutrals: cafes, hotels, cinemas (das Mariott, das Cinemaxx), chemical elements (Helium, Arsen; however it is: der Schwefel, masculine elements have the suffix -stoff), letters, notes, languages and colors (das Orange, das A, das Englische), certain brand names for detergents and cleaning products (Ariel, Persil), continents, countries (die artikellosen: (das alte) Europa; however exceptions include: der Libanon, die Schweiz …).

German declension of Zuspitzung?

How does the declension of Zuspitzung work in the nominative, accusative, dative and genitive cases? Here you can find all forms in the singular as well as in the plural:

1 Singular Plural
Nominative die Zuspitzung die Zuspitzungen
Genitive der Zuspitzung der Zuspitzungen
Dative der Zuspitzung den Zuspitzungen
Akkusative die Zuspitzung die Zuspitzungen

What is the meaning of Zuspitzung in German?

Zuspitzung is defined as:

[1] work towards an extreme state or the case that it has been reached

How to use Zuspitzung in a sentence?

Example sentences in German using Zuspitzung with translations in English.

[1] „Zum Zeitpunkt dieser extremen Zuspitzung griffen die ersten Maßnahmen zur Behebung des Engpasses bereits.“

[1] "At the time of this extreme intensification, the first measures to remedy the bottleneck already grabbed"

[1] „Der Roman wird in vielen grotesken Zuspitzungen auf das Haus, ja die Wohnung konzentriert, aus der die Protagonisten allmählich von einem Nazi hinausgedrängt werden.“

[1] "The novel is concentrated on the house in many grotesque exaggerations, indeed the apartment, from which the protagonists are gradually being pushed out of a Nazi"
